Macoszyn Mały
Village in Lublin Voivodeship, Poland
51°23′N 23°31′E / 51.383°N 23.517°E / 51.383; 23.517Macoszyn Mały [maˈt͡sɔʂɨn ˈmawɨ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Hańsk, within Włodawa County, Lublin Voivodeship, in eastern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 9 kilometres (6 mi) east of Hańsk, 19 km (12 mi) south of Włodawa, and 68 km (42 mi) east of the regional capital Lublin.
